August 25

Devotion

Nevertheless, at thy word. Luke 5:5.

Oh, what a blessed formula for us! This path of mine is dark, mysterious, perplexing;  nevertheless, at Thy word  I will go forward. This trial of mine is cutting, sore for flesh and blood to bear. It is hard to breathe through a broken heart, Thy will be done. But,  nevertheless, at Thy word  I will say, Even so, Father! This besetting habit, or infirmity, or sin of mine, is difficult to crucify. It has become part of myself a second nature; to be severed from it would be like the cutting off of a right hand, or the plucking out of a right eye;  nevertheless, at Thy word  I will lay aside every weight; this idol I will utterly abolish. This righteousness of mine it is hard to ignore; all these virtues, and amiabilities, and natural graces, it is hard to believe that they dare not in any way be mixed up in the matter of my salvation; and that I am to receive all from first to last as the gift of God, through Jesus Christ my Lord.  Nevertheless, at Thy word  I will count all but loss for the excellency of His knowledge. Macduff.
